notice how there isn't much smoke? these were used during WW2 in Finland and northern Europe, like where Belarus is. the reason is that the smoke and flickering flames would alert the enemy, this method forces the fire inside to reduce light and the enclosed space allows the smoke to burn too, no waste and no choking smoke :D
